Why Edit Your Kitchen Remodel Photos?
Editing your kitchen remodel photos isn't just about making them look pretty. It's about showcasing the quality of your work, highlighting unique features, and helping potential clients visualize themselves in the space. Here are a few reasons why editing is crucial:

- Enhances the overall aesthetic and professionalism of your portfolio.
- Corrects lighting issues and ensures consistency across all photos.
- Draws attention to key features and design elements.
- Helps potential clients see the 'before and after' transformation more clearly.
Top Kitchen Remodel Photo Editor Tools

With numerous photo editing tools available, it can be overwhelming to choose the right one. We've compiled a list of top kitchen remodel photo editor tools, each with its unique features and benefits:
| Tool | Key Features | Pricing |
|---|---|---|
| Adobe Photoshop Lightroom | Advanced editing tools, mobile sync, and cloud storage. | Subscription-based, starting at $9.99/month. |
| Skylum Luminar | AI-powered tools, customizable workspace, and easy-to-use interface. | One-time purchase, starting at $69. |
| ON1 Photo RAW | Non-destructive editing, local adjustments, and AI-powered tools. | Subscription-based, starting at $9.99/month, or one-time purchase at $99.99. |
Essential Editing Techniques for Kitchen Remodel Photos

While each tool has its unique features, there are some essential editing techniques that apply to all:
1. Crop and Straighten
Ensure your photos are well-composed and level by cropping and straightening them.

2. Adjust Exposure and Contrast
Correct any lighting issues and enhance the mood of your photos by adjusting exposure and contrast.




















3. Enhance Colors
Boost the vibrancy of colors, especially in cabinetry, countertops, and backsplashes, to make them pop.
4. Remove Distractions
Use the clone stamp or healing brush tools to remove any distracting elements, like trash cans, cords, or personal items.
5. Add Text and Graphics
Include 'before and after' labels, your logo, or other branding elements to make your photos stand out.
Tips for Editing Kitchen Remodel Photos
Before you dive into editing, consider these tips to ensure your photos look their best:
- Shoot in RAW format to capture the most data and have more room for editing.
- Use a tripod to ensure consistency in perspective and lighting across multiple shots.
- Consider hiring a professional photographer if you're not confident in your photography skills.
- Edit photos in batches to save time and maintain consistency.
